Use Cases and Deployment Scope

I use Bing Maps in several ways mostly as the aerial view to get a good look at the facilities and warehouses company drivers pick up and deliver to. This helps identify any obstacles in the roadways, whether or not the vehicle is traveling through residential areas or obstructions in the facility.

Pros

  • Close ups on the street 360 is very clear
  • The to and from for directions is very accurate
  • The features are very user-friendly

Cons

  • Would like to see integration of more commercial vehicle features
  • A feature that gives toll prices in advance would be helpful
  • Weather alerts would be a good feature to include

Likelihood to Recommend

Bing Maps is well suited for preplanning loads, specifically in regards to checking the bird's eye and aerial view to see if the facility has enough area or room for overnight parking. And if overnight parking is available, what number of restaurants are within walking distance from the business in the area.

Use Cases and Deployment Scope

Bing Maps is used for locating of sites for the various projects we work on. It is also used to obtain directions and the distance to travel to these sites across Africa. Using the aerial background backdrop and street views allow us to determine the layout of the site and and characteristics of the terrain and surrounding services, and what the land is like in a preliminary state before we go to the actual site.

Pros

  • provides clear directions
  • street views allow preliminary identification of site layout and surrounding services
  • clear background aerial imagery

Cons

  • include more features
  • make it compatible with other data that can be imported

Likelihood to Recommend

Bing Maps gives access to clear background aerial imagery. The imagery and street views are quite up to date which helps quite a bit. There should, however, be more features included on Bing Maps.

Use Cases and Deployment Scope

I use Bing Maps to manage locations for our business addresses at Streitwise. This entails multiple locations we own and placing the property locations on the map for users that are visiting the property can see. This helps Bing users view our locations we own when traveling to the properties.

Pros

  • Location management
  • Navigation for end users
  • UX

Cons

  • Needs to be easier to claim businesses that don't have addresses we can access with mail
  • Easier experience managing multiple properties
  • More collaborative abilities with property managers

Likelihood to Recommend

Bing Maps is essential for local SEO management and on-site marketing for those that own or manage property locations. This greatly enhances local marketers at the hyperlocal level manage their businesses more effectively and help customers find the business locations when using Bing Maps or Bings Search. This also helps those that have shifting business hours.
